- Heat and Mains: Racers are grouped depending on their ranking(*). There isn't resort on this format. Only staring grid order is changed based on the "Start Order" property.
- PN Racing. It's based on the PNRWC rules. I think this is what you want.
The Heats are configured based on the racer's ranking(*). The race tree holds two "Qualifying Heats" nodes, the first one has the first two rounds, the last one has the third round.
- Heat, Semifinal & Final: There is no resort on Heats, the difference is how the Mains are sorted. You can see the details in ZRound Quick Start Guide
(*) You always can put a racer on any heat by editing the inscription properties

I managed to figure this out as there are no instructions.
In setting up an event (I don't know that this is possible if not created as event), there is a 'resort' button to the bottom right. you will come back to this later.
I created classes using the PN Racing format that includes multiple rounds of qualifying. I unchecked 'Prequalify' option under training tab. No idea what this does so decided not to mess with it. I used the Q1+Q2+... method as we only wanted two rounds, not three.
Setup and run your first qualifier as you would typically do. Once all heats are done for Q1, go back to the Event screen and click the 'Resort' button while the class you are running is selected in the menu above. Go back to the class screen and click on Q1 and then 'Generate Heats' to the right. This will resort and populate Q2 using Q1 results. Keep doing this process up to Q5 is you wish however we stopped at Q2. Once Q2 was done, select qualifying heats in the left menu and then select 'Generate Mains' on the right.
This allowed us to run multiple rounds of qualifying, reshuffling between rounds and generate mains from these results. It would have been easy to follow the PN format but it requires more time than we had as we were aiming for 5 classes and finished 4! Not bad for a single day's racing.
